Box Score WILLIAMSPORT, Pa. – The top of the Lycoming College baseball team's lineup continued to impress with the first three batters combining for seven hits to lead the team on Friday, March 17, as it fell to DeSales University, 16-6, in the opening game of a three-game MAC Freedom set at Weiland Park.

First-year
Nick Reeder (Montoursville, Pa./Montoursville Area) went 2-for-4 with a run, junior
Braden Campbell (Centerville, Utah/Cooper Hills) went 2-for-4 with two doubles, a run and two RBI and first-year
Greg Wirin (Interlaken, N.J./Christian Brothers Academy) went 3-for-4 with a run, a double and two RBI.

The Warriors (1-9 overall, 0-3 MAC Freedom) got to work in the fourth inning, scoring two runs, as Wirin and first-year
Nick Hoheb (Brick, N.J./Brick Township) singled with one out before an error helped Wirin score, setting up an RBI double from first-year
Kai Foster (West Milford, N.J./West Milford).

In the fifth, the Warriors added three runs, with first-year
Mason Drozal (Stroudsburg, Pa./Stroudsburg) reaching on a walk before Reeder walked and Campbell drove both in with a double to left center. Wirin followed with a double of his own.

In the seventh, Drozal walked before Reeder reached on a bunt single, setting up an RBI single from Wirin.

Carson Allison led the Bulldogs, going 5-for-5 with three runs and two doubles. Joe Grigas went 2-for-3 with three runs, a homer and three RBI. Colin Tremblay drove in seven runs, hitting a grand slam in the second inning, as DeSales scored 10 in the first three innings.

Ryan Rieber pitched five innings, allowing eight hits, five runs, a walk and he struck out three to earn the win. First-year
Treyson Green (Celebration, Fla./Windermere Prep) (0-1) took the loss, allowing four runs in one inning of work.
